Doug Weber paints dogs and the women who love them.

This subject mirrors how he feels about painting:
To Weber, painting is the unconditional love and devotion to the look and feel of something you love in your life.
Weber is also a figurative artist who paints from models in what he calls, "The Still Life Movement". This experience of being present with someone in real time forms an intimacy unique to painting. Weber also works in another style suitable to wood block printing, an expressionistic medium that pairs well with pop art.
